BEML Limited is making significant strides in expanding its operational capabilities and financial support for critical manufacturing sectors in India.

The company has recently entered into a strategic Memorandum of Understanding (MoU) with Sagarmala Finance Corporation Limited. This collaboration is designed to unlock dedicated financial assistance crucial for bolstering India's domestic maritime manufacturing ecosystem. In parallel, BEML has signed another MoU with HD Korea and Hyundai Samho, which is expected to broaden its footprint in the manufacturing of maritime cranes and other port equipment.

These developments come at a time when BEML has been securing substantial orders. This past week alone saw BEML receive a significant ₹157 crore order from Loram Rail Maintenance India for switch rail grinding machines, destined for Indian Railways' track maintenance operations. Earlier in the week, the company clinched a ₹414 crore contract from Bangalore Metro Rail Corporation to supply additional trainsets for the Namma Metro Phase II project.

BEML's Business Verticals

  • BEML's core business areas include defence and aerospace, mining and construction, and rail and metro.
  • The recent orders highlight the growing importance and capability of its rail and metro segment.

Company Background and Financials

  • BEML Limited is a 'Schedule A' public sector enterprise under the administrative control of the Ministry of Defence.
  • The Government of India remains the majority shareholder, holding a 53.86 percent stake as of June 30, 2025.
  • In the July–September quarter of FY26, BEML reported a net profit of ₹48 crore, a 6 percent decrease year-on-year.
  • Revenue for the quarter dipped by 2.4 percent to ₹839 crore.
  • EBITDA remained steady at ₹73 crore, with operating margins slightly improving to 8.7 percent from 8.5 percent.
